A satellite is projected vertically upwards from an earth station. At what height above the earth's surface will the force on the satellite due to the earth be reduced to half its value at the earth station? (Radius of the earth is 6400 km)

Given radius of Earth = 6400Km


Let M be the mass of earth and m be the mass of the satellite.


Let us assume, at height h, the force on the satellite due to earth is reduce to half.


We know gravitational force between two mass of objects,



Where,


G = universal gravitation constant =


m1 =mass of first object = M


m2 = mass of second object = m


r = distance between the objects


On Earth surface, the force on the satellite due to the earth is given by –



On reaching a height h, the force on the satellite due to the earth is given by –



From question,



Taking square root on both sides –
